Thank You  the document  effective date 18 July 2025 has two sections that are particularlly  relevant to those who took earlier free extra box offers as they clarify when EE might charge  for the boxes.

Specifically section (clause 10)

Customers on any EE TV plan who took an Extra Box(es) on or before 17 July 2025 can retain
their extra box(es) at no extra cost for the remainder of their current contract. Please see
clause 13 (below) for more information on what happens to the extra box(es) after this
contract expires.

And section (clause 13)

If your contract expires, you will no longer be eligible for this Offer. You will need to (i) return
your extra box(es) to EE in accordance with Clause 10 (above), or (ii) pay for each extra box
on a monthly basis in accordance with clauses 7 and 8 (as applicable). This also applies to
customers who re-contract, re-grade, upgrade (excluding upgrades to Full Works packages)
or downgrade to EE TV plans.
